Full title: Latin America and the International System: a turning point? Multidisciplinary perspectives on Venezuela

Introduction: prof. Matteo Legrenzi, Ca’ Foscari University of Venice

  • Prof. Andrea Ruggeri, University of Milan and SGRI - Sovereignty in the International System from an IR perspective
  • Prof. Sara De Vido, Ca’ Foscari University of Venice - Whither International Law? Sovereignty and the prohibition of the use of force after the intervention in Venezuela
  • Prof. Luis Fernando Beneduzi, Ca’ Foscari University of Venice - U.S. Interests in Latin America: A historical perspective
  • Dr. Felipe Krause, Oxford University - The Political Economy of Drug Policy in Latin America
  • Prof. Valerio Dotti, Ca’ Foscari University of Venice - Sovereignty and Energy Economics in Venezuela: How “investable” is Venezuela?
  • Prof. Matteo Cosci, Ca’ Foscari University of Venice - Costantino Acosta’s philosophy of law for a future Venezuela
